# Break-Glass: Catalog Cache Invalidation

Scope: the Pinrow product catalog at Veldstone Retail. If stale prices persist after a purge and the Hollowmere invalidation queue is wedged, use break-glass to flush the edge tier directly. Contractors: get verbal sign-off from the catalog lead first. Steps: open the Hollowmere admin shell, select emergency-flush, confirm the tenant, and run it once — repeated flushes thrash the origin. Access is logged and expires after 20 minutes. Unseal the admin shell with the passphrase below.

recovery phrase for kahop-tajog: istix-casvan

# Reminder Job — Session Handling

The Pinefield clinic reminder job runs hourly. It opens one session against the scheduling API, batches reminders, then closes the session. Sessions expire after 15 minutes; stale sessions cause silent skips, not errors. Check the job log for "session renewed" lines first. To re-run a missed batch manually, call the trigger endpoint with the bearer token below.

session JWT of yawep-yawep = eyJhbGciOiJIUzI1NiIsInR5cCI6IkpXVCJ9.eyJzdWIiOiI3pWF3_In0.aXYsHiog

Release Checklist — Pointsgrain Loyalty Ledger

Security review item 6. Confirm ledger entries are append-only: migrations must not add UPDATE or DELETE grants to the writer role. Verify balance adjustments go through the signed-adjustment path only, with dual approval enforced in the Corvid admin panel. Check that the reconciliation export redacts member identifiers. Run the tamper-detection suite against the release candidate and attach results. Sign-off requires the verified candidate's token, which is recorded below.

pipeline stamp: htk31_f769b577b3028a4e9958e5bb8d1259a

**Vendor note: Inkmill markdown pipeline**

Rendering for Parchway docs is outsourced to Inkmill under an annual contract, renewing each March. They handle sanitization and PDF export; we own the upload queue. SLA: 4-hour response on rendering failures. Escalate only after two failed retries. Their support desk is reachable at the address below.

billing contact of hahaf-baguf = zorael.tammir.jorius@sivrelhq.internal